Henry Vaughan’s grave at Llansantffraed Church restored

The grave of internationally-renowned poet Henry Vaughan has undergone a £10,000 restoration. Henry Vaughan lived near Talybont on Usk and wrote poetry about our beautiful landscape. Talybont has a circular walk, starting in the village, which is named after him … Continue reading

Canalathon 2014 – Sunday 14th September

On the 14th of September 55 teams of four will be completing the 33 mile Canalathon route by canoe, bike and on foot along the Mon & Brec canal. It will pass through Talybont on Usk in its last stages. … Continue reading
